22 Christmas Mantel Decor Ideas: Festive, Cozy Holiday Touches
Christmas is a magical time of year, and decorating your home is a big part of getting into the holiday spirit. One spot that often becomes a focal point for festive cheer is the fireplace mantel.
With so many ways to adorn this space, it’s easy to create a beautiful holiday display that reflects your personal style.

From garlands and stockings to twinkling lights and ornaments, there are countless options for transforming your mantel into a winter wonderland. Whether you prefer a classic look with red and green or a more modern approach with cool blues and silvers, the right decor can set the tone for your entire living room.
Adding some festive touches to your mantel is a simple way to spread holiday joy throughout your home.
Festive Garland With Pine Cones

A lush evergreen garland adorned with pine cones brings nature’s beauty indoors for the holidays. This charming decoration adds rustic elegance to any mantel.
Twinkling LED Lights

Tiny twinkling LED lights add a magical sparkle to your Christmas mantel. These dainty fairy lights create a warm, inviting glow that brings the holiday spirit to life.
Velvet Mantel Scarves

Drape your mantel in luxurious velvet for a touch of holiday elegance. A deep red or emerald green velvet scarf adds rich texture and color to your festive display.
Vintage Christmas Lanterns

Antique lanterns add a warm, nostalgic glow to holiday mantels. Try placing a few red or green metal lanterns filled with flickering battery-operated candles among pine boughs and ornaments. Their soft light creates cozy Christmas magic.
Rustic Wooden Signs

Add a charming touch to your mantel with adorable rustic wooden signs. These cute decorations bring warmth and personality to your holiday display.
Personalized Christmas Stockings

Add a touch of whimsy to your mantel with cute personalized stockings! Embroider names, use fun patterns, or add sparkly accents to make each stocking special and unique.
Plaid Ribbons and Bows

Festive plaid ribbons and bows add a cozy touch to Christmas mantel decor. Wrap them around garlands or tie them to stockings for a cheerful pop of color and pattern.
Mason Jar Snow Globes

Transform your mantel into a winter wonderland with charming Mason jar snow globes. These DIY delights are easy to make and add a magical sparkle to your holiday decor. Fill jars with miniature festive figurines, fake snow, and glitter for an enchanting display.
Winter Village Scene

Create a whimsical winter wonderland on your mantel with a miniature village scene. Arrange tiny snow-covered houses, twinkling trees, and tiny figurines to bring the magic of a festive town to life.
Mirror with Garland Trim

A dazzling mirror adorned with lush evergreen garland transforms into a festive focal point. Twinkling lights woven through the greenery add a magical sparkle, reflecting beautifully in the glass.
Family Photo Holiday Frames

Add a personal touch to your mantel with festive frames showcasing cherished family photos. Sprinkle in some jolly holiday spirit by using red and green frames or ones decorated with sparkly snowflakes. Mix in a few ornaments and fairy lights for extra cheer.
Oversized Knit Stockings

Cozy up your mantel with chunky, oversized knit stockings for a warm and inviting holiday look. These plush beauties add a soft touch of texture and whimsy to your Christmas decor.
Mounted Reindeer

Bring a touch of woodland whimsy to your holiday mantel with charming antler stocking holders. These elegant pieces add rustic flair while securely displaying festive stockings filled with Christmas goodies.
Colorful Ball Garland

A festive string of vibrant ornaments adds a playful pop to any mantel. Mix shiny, matte, and glittery balls in cheerful hues for a merry and bright display.
Oversized Sleigh Decor

Make a grand statement with a charming oversized sleigh on your mantel this Christmas. This whimsical centerpiece adds a touch of magic and wonder to your holiday decor.
Christmas Quotes on Canvas

Sprinkle some holiday magic on your mantel with charming canvas prints featuring beloved Christmas quotes. These cozy decorations add a warm, personal touch to your festive display.
Lanterns With Faux Flames

Cozy lanterns with flickering faux flames add a touch of magic to any Christmas mantel. These charming decorations create a warm glow without the fire risk of real candles.
Winterberry and Pinecone Swag

A charming winterberry and pinecone swag adds a touch of natural beauty to your Christmas mantel. This festive decoration combines bright red berries with rustic pinecones for a lovely woodland feel.
Eucalyptus and Red Berry Garland

A lush eucalyptus garland adorned with bright red berries brings a fresh, festive touch to any Christmas mantel. This gorgeous greenery adds a natural, elegant look while the cheery pops of red create holiday magic.
Rustic Plaid Garland

Wrap your mantel in cozy charm with a plaid garland that brings a touch of cabin-inspired warmth to your holiday decor. This festive accent mixes traditional tartan patterns with pine branches and pinecones for a rustic, outdoorsy feel.
Chalk Painted Wooden Trees

Darling wooden trees adorned with soft chalk paint bring a whimsical touch to any Christmas mantel. These charming decorations add a cozy, handmade feel to holiday displays.
Soft Glow Lanterns

Charming lanterns filled with flickering LED candles cast a warm, inviting glow across the mantel. These enchanting decorations create a cozy atmosphere. It’s perfect for snuggling up on chilly winter nights.